Title: Direct Endorsement Mortgage Underwriter
Department: Mortgage Lending
Reports to: Associate Vice President of Mortgage Lending
FLSA: Non-Exempt
Job Grade: 13
Job Purpose: Ensures that conventional and portfolio mortgage loans are underwritten in a timely manner and according to credit union and investor policies as well as legal requirements.

This position allows for an optional hybrid work arrangement which includes a combination of both in-office and remote work arrangements. (Maximum of two days remote, three days in-office). To be eligible for the program, employees must complete a minimum of 90 days of continuous, regular employment, be in good standing, and submit a formal hybrid work application prior to being eligible for hybrid work, pending supervisor approval. Work schedules will be established by the employee's supervisor according to business needs. Working locations and schedules may be altered at management discretion.
